Online Admission Application
A completed online application and $60 application fee must be submitted. Online Admission Application
Child Play Session
After receipt of your application and fee, the Admission Office will contact you to schedule a play session for your child.
Admission Testing
Applicants age six and older should submit results from the WISC-V (Wechsler Intelligence Scale for Children, 5th edition.) Admission Testing Sites. Applicants under six years old are not required to submit admissions testing.
Recommendation Forms
Recommendation forms should be submitted for PreK, Kindergarten, 1st, 2nd, and 3rd Grade applicants.
